WebJan 17, 2024 · When left to her own devices, a peahen will lay several eggs. Her daily laying normally goes on for 6 to 10 days. After she finishes, she’ll spend 28 days or so sitting on her clutch until her babies hatch. For most peahens, they can l ay and hatch 2 clutches a year.
